During the Spanish Super Cup match between Barcelona and Madrid, a man invaded the pitch to celebrate Catalonia's team success with the brightest stars.

In the 70th minute, Lionel Messi converted a penalty from 11 meters, and just moments later the leader of the Catalonia team was greeted with a precise shot not only by Alexis Sanchez, but also by some stranger.

The Russian news portal aif.ru reports that this man is a member of the "Capitals" fan group of Moscow's "Dynamo" team. The inscription on the back of his shirt in Cyrillic read: "Small from the outside, but a good fighter from the inside."

It is likely that Messi and Sanchez did not react positively to this intrusion - the intruder was soon subdued and escorted out of the field by stadium security.

According to the same source, Dynamo fans from the "Capitals" group arrived in the capital of Catalonia on the same evening from Stuttgart, where the Moscow team was playing a UEFA Europa League match.
